Catalog description
Prerequisite: Completion of ELEC 110. Builds on the student’s knowledge of electrical theory. Experiments with the interaction between magnetism, generators, transformers, motors, and how it applies to the AC circuit. Inductance and capacitance theories are introduced. Practical application of electrical circuits in residential, commercial and industrial setting. Construction requirements of single phase/3-phase systems, and electrical safety. (AVC)
